Synthetic resin roof tiles have emerged as a popular choice in the roofing material market, thanks to their unique properties and advantages over traditional roofing materials. Made from a combination of synthetic resins and other additives, these tiles offer a range of benefits that make them suitable for various applications in both residential and commercial buildings.
One of the primary advantages of synthetic resin roof tiles is their exceptional durability. Unlike traditional roofing materials, such as wood or clay, these tiles are resistant to adverse weather conditions, including heavy rain, snow, and extreme temperatures. This resilience means that synthetic resin roof tiles can withstand the test of time, requiring minimal maintenance and replacement. Their longevity can significantly reduce lifecycle costs, making them an economically viable option for property owners.
In addition to durability, synthetic resin roof tiles are known for their aesthetic versatility. Available in a wide array of colors, shapes, and finishes, these tiles can mimic the appearance of traditional materials like slate or terracotta. This allows homeowners and builders to achieve the desired architectural look without sacrificing performance. The versatility of synthetic resin roof tiles means they can complement various design styles, from contemporary to classic.
Another notable benefit of synthetic resin roof tiles is their lightweight nature. Compared to traditional roofing materials, these tiles are much lighter, making them easier to transport and install. This characteristic can reduce labor costs and installation time, benefiting both contractors and homeowners. Moreover, the lightweight aspect also means that less structural support is required, which can lead to additional savings during the construction process.
Additionally, synthetic resin roof tiles are often designed with environmental sustainability in mind. Many manufacturers utilize recycled materials in their production processes, contributing to a reduced carbon footprint. Furthermore, synthetic resin tiles can be manufactured to reflect sunlight, which helps in reducing heat absorption and lowering energy costs for heating and cooling in buildings.
In conclusion, synthetic resin roof tiles present a range of advantages, including durability, aesthetic flexibility, lightweight characteristics, and environmental benefits. As the construction industry continues to evolve, these innovative roofing materials are becoming increasingly popular due to their ability to meet modern demands for performance and sustainability.
